Chapter 2: Problem 96
Slope of a tangent line a. Sketch a graph of \(y=3^{x}\) and carefully draw four secant lines connecting the points \(P(0,1)\) and \(Q\left(x, 3^{x}\right),\) for \(x=-2,-1,1,\) and 2. b. Find the slope of the line that passes through \(P(0,1)\) and \(Q\left(x, 3^{x}\right),\) for \(x \neq 0\). c. Complete the table and make a conjecture about the value of \(\lim _{x \rightarrow 0} \frac{3^{x}-1}{x}\). $$\begin{array}{|l|l|l|l|l|l|l|l|l|} \hline x & -0.1 & -0.01 & -0.001 & -0.0001 & 0.0001 & 0.001 & 0.01 & 0.1 \\ \hline \frac{3^{x}-1}{x} & & & & & & & & \\ \hline \end{array}$$
